Accessible Career Experts

The Career Management Group also offers a broad range of services from experienced advisors, coaches, managers, and practitioners at all stages of the career planning process.

  • Career Coaches – Experienced professionals help you frame your self-development goals and your recruiting strategy to find work that is meaningful to you.
  • Relationship Managers – Senior-level account managers maintain hundreds of relationships with companies.
  • Industry Advisors – Our part-time cadre of seasoned professionals who bring years of front-line industry and functional experience to each one-on-one session with students.
  • CMG Peer Advisors – A select group of experienced second-year MBA students who advise first-year students through the interview and job search processes.

Extensive Training Programs and Activities

The Career Management Group offers a full schedule of diverse programs and activities to prepare you for success.

  • Career Fundamentals Workshops – Daily workshops on job search topics such as resume and cover letter writing, networking, interview strategies, pitching, and more.
  • Case and Interview Preparation – Firms such as JP Morgan, Goldman Sachs, Clorox, Bain, and McKinsey & Co. are invited into the classroom to train students how to apply their classroom skills in the interview room.
  • Job Search Teams – An intensive six-week program that utilizes teamwork and Haas expertise helps you quickly launch a strong job search in your chosen field.
  • Specific Industry Programs – A diverse set of activities and events tailored to specific industries, such as the Analyzing Careers in Real Estate Program (ACRE) or the Investment Banking Fellows Program, which both partner students with relevant alumni.
